He provides courses for Maths, Science, Social Science, Physics, Chemistry, Computer Science at Teachoo. property management rights brisbaneWeb1 nov. 2024 · When the GMAT provides the square root sign for an even root, such as a square root, then the only accepted answer is the positive root. That is, 16 = 4, NOT +4 or -4. In contrast, the equation x^2 = 16 has TWO solutions, +4 and -4. Even roots have only a positive value on the GMAT. Odd roots will have the same sign as the base of the root. property management saint cloud flWebFinal answer. Step 1/1.
